Abstract
INTRODUCTION: In 5%-10% of patients with familial Mediterranean fever (FMF), colchicine is not effective in preventing inflammatory attacks. Another 5%-10% of patients are intolerant to effective doses of colchicine and experience serious side effects. Treatment with anti-interleukin-1 (IL-1) drugs may be an alternative for these patients, although it is not reimbursed for this indication in many countries.Entities:

Effect of anakinra
| Study | Patients included (N) | Sex (male), (N) | Age (adult), (N) | Type AA amyloidosis (N) | Reason for starting anti-IL-1 (resistance/toxicity) | Complete response (N) | Follow-up (months) |
|---|---|---|---|---|---|---|---|
| Chae et al | 1 | 1 | 1 | 1 | 0/1 | 1 | 6 |
| Belkhir et al | 1 | 0 | 1 | 1 | 1/1 | 1 | 5 |
| Gattringer et al | 2 | 0 | 2 | 0 | 2/0 | 2 | 4.5 |
| Kuijk et al | 1 | 0 | 0 | 0 | 1/0 | 1 | 9 |
| Calligaris et al | 1 | 0 | 0 | 0 | 1/0 | 0 | 15 |
| Mitroulis et al | 1 | 1 | 1 | 0 | 1/0 | 1 | 6 |
| Roldan et al | 1 | 1 | 0 | 0 | 1/0 | 1 | 6 |
| Moser et al | 1 | 1 | 1 | 1 | 1/0 | 1 | 20 |
| Petropoulou et al | 1 | 1 | 1 | 0 | 1/0 | 1 | 4 |
| Meinzer et al | 6 | 4 | 0 | 0 | 5/1 | 5 | 73 |
| Özen et al | 3 | 2 | 0 | 0 | 3/0 | 1 | 48 |
| Alpay et al | 1 | 1 | 1 | 1 | 0/1 | 1 | 2 |
| Hennig et al | 1 | 1 | 1 | 1 | 1/0 | 1 | NR |
| Stankovic Stojanovic et al | 4 | 1 | 4 | 4 | 4/0 | 4 | 56 |
| Estublier et al | 1 | 1 | 1 | 0 | 1/0 | 1 | 12 |
| Soriano et al | 1 | 1 | 1 | 0 | 0/1 | 1 | 17 |
| Celebi et al | 1 | 0 | 1 | 1 | 1/0 | 1 | 8 |
| Mercan et al | 2 | 0 | 2 | 0 | 2/1 | 2 | 3 |
| Özçakar et al | 10 | 4 | 3 | 6 | 10/1 | 8 | 179 |
| Cetin et al | 12 | 7 | 10 | 1 | 12/1 | 7 | 198 |
| Eroglu et al | 11 | NR | NR | 1 | 11/1 | 7 | 172 |
| Sevillano et al | 1 | 1 | 1 | 1 | 1/1 | 1 | 42 |
Abbreviations: IL-1, interleukin-1; NR, not reported.
Effect of canakinumab
| Study | Patients included (N) | Sex (male), (N) | Age (adult), (N) | Type AA amyloidosis (N) | Reason for starting anti-IL-1 (resistance/toxicity) | Complete response (N) | Follow-up (months) |
|---|---|---|---|---|---|---|---|
| Meinzer et al | 2 | 1 | 0 | 0 | 2/0 | 2 | 9 |
| Mitroulis et al | 1 | 0 | 1 | 0 | 1/0 | 1 | 24 |
| Brik et al | 7 | 5 | 0 | 0 | 7/0 | 3 | 42 |
| Özçakar et al | 3 | 0 | 2 | 0 | 3/0 | 0 | 56 |
| Alpa and Roccatello | 1 | 0 | 1 | 0 | 1/0 | 0 | 24 |
| Cetin et al | 8 | 4 | 6 | 0 | 8/0 | 6 | 137 |
| Eroglu et al | 9 | NR | NR | 1 | 9/0 | 7 | 108 |
| Gül et al | 9 | 7 | NR | 0 | 9/0 | 8 | 27 |
Abbreviations: IL-1, interleukin-1; NR, not reported.
